RICHARD OSMAN'S HOUSE OF GAMES: THIS WEEK'S CELEBRITY GUESTS REVEALED
Richard Osman hosts the teatime quiz where a group of four famous faces go toe to toe in testing their general knowledge skills in a variety of entertaining games. This week's contestants are Fatiha El-Ghorri, Patrick Grant, Mr Motivator and Lauren Oakley. A daily winner is declared following a quickfire round at the end of each show, and the scores are tallied across the week, resulting in an overall champion being crowned on Friday. ONCE UPON A TIME IN AMERICA: BBC MARKS 250 YEARS SINCE DELARATION OF INDEPENDENCE IN NEW SERIES
As the United States of America approaches 250 years since signing the Declaration of Independence, and at a time when many people are contemplating what the future for the country holds, this five-part series will ask what it means to be American. Starting with the social and cultural revolutions of the 1960s and their impact over more recent years, the series focuses on human stories at the heart of modern America and tackles issues of race, religion and politics. EMERGENCY 24/7: BBC FOLLOW THE WORK OF MAJOR TRAUMA CENTRE FOR NEW FACTUAL SERIES
Emergency 24/7 is embedded inside the busy Emergency Department at Southmead Hospital, a Major Trauma Centre in Bristol, to reveal the everyday pressures as well as the complex teamwork required to keep the department running. It will follow staff as they look after patients from diagnosis through to their treatment, encountering everything from car crash amputations, stabbings and third-degree burns. CHILDREN OF THE BLITZ: BBC ANNOUNCES FEATURE-LENGTH DOCUMENTARY
During The Blitz, the British government had plans in place to evacuate approximately 3.5 million people, but only around 1.5 million left towns and cities for the countryside, with the majority of those being children. Children of the Blitz tells the stories of those who remained at home, often to help their families, or because their parents couldn’t bear to send them away.
